Ebook Readers: Choosing the Right Device
Selecting the perfect reader for your book-loving habit can feel complex, but it doesn't have to be. Consider your budget first; choices vary widely in cost. Next, think about screen size; a larger screen is more comfortable for some, while a more compact one is ideal for on-the-go use. Finally, consider features like illumination, operating time, and memory space to ensure you get a enjoyable experience.

Development of the UK Book
The story of the English book extends far past the familiar printed page. Initially limited to illuminated manuscripts, the first books were luxury items, accessible only to a privileged few . The invention of the mechanical press by Gutenberg marked a crucial shift, enabling widespread production and making literature more available . From the emerging days of lettering and painstaking processes, the book has experienced continual transformation , utilizing innovations in construction techniques, parchment quality, and eventually, virtual formats, altering the very nature of what it represents to read a book.
